The creamy filling is crucial to the success of this recipe. Ingredients such as cream cheese and sour cream provide a rich, velvety texture that envelops the spinach and artichokes. Cream cheese acts as a binder, ensuring that the mixture holds together well when baked, while sour cream adds a tangy flavor that elevates the overall taste.

Cheeses play a vital role in enhancing both flavor and texture. Parmesan cheese contributes a sharp, nutty flavor and helps to create a golden crust when baked. On the other hand, mozzarella cheese adds a delightful stretchiness and creaminess to the filling, making each bite irresistibly gooey.

Finally, the use of puff pastry is what sets this appetizer apart from traditional spinach artichoke dip. Puff pastry is a light, flaky dough made from layers of butter and flour. When baked, it puffs up and creates a crispy exterior that contrasts beautifully with the creamy filling inside. Preparation Essentials

The success of any dish often lies in the quality of its ingredients. For these Crispy Spinach Artichoke Bites, using fresh ingredients is paramount to achieving optimal flavor. Fresh spinach will impart a vibrant taste compared to frozen varieties, while fresh artichokes, although more labor-intensive to prepare, offer a superior texture and flavor profile.

If you opt for canned or frozen artichokes, ensure they are well-drained before mixing them into the filling. This prevents excess moisture from making the filling soggy. Similarly, when using frozen spinach, it’s crucial to squeeze out any excess water after thawing to maintain the right consistency.

Ingredients
  

1 cup fresh spinach, chopped

1 cup canned artichoke hearts, drained and roughly chopped

1/2 cup cream cheese, softened

1/2 cup sour cream

1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ese

1/4 teaspoon garlic powder

1/4 teaspoon onion powder

Salt and pepper to taste

1 package (1 lb) puff pastry sheets, thawed

1 egg (for egg wash)

Olive oil spray (for crisping)

Instructions
 

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

    Make the Filling: In a medium mixing bowl, combine the chopped spinach, chopped artichoke hearts, cream cheese, sour cream, Parmesan cheese, mozzarella cheese,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.

      Prepare the Puff Pastry: On a floured surface, take one sheet of puff pastry and roll it out to about 1/8 inch thickness. Cut into 3-inch squares. You should be able to create about 12 squares from one sheet. Repeat with the second sheet.

        Fill the Pastry: Place a tablespoon-sized scoop of the spinach artichoke mixture into the center of each pastry square. Be careful not to overfill, or they may burst while baking.

          Seal the Bites: Fold each pastry square into a triangle, pressing the edges together to seal tightly. You can use a fork to crimp the edges for extra security and decoration.

            Brush and Bake: In a small bowl, whisk the egg and brush the mixture over the top of each pastry for a golden sheen. Lightly spray the tops with olive oil spray for extra crispiness.

              Bake: Place the bites on the prepared baking sheet and b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and puffed up.

                Cool and Serve: Once out of the oven, let them cool for a few minutes before serving. These bites are best enjoyed warm and can be paired with your favorite dipping sauce like marinara or ranch dressing.

                  Prep Time: 20 mins | Total Time: 45 mins | Servings: 24 bites
